Expressing God’s Love Through Acts of Kindness

When it comes to demonstrating our faith and spreading God’s love, there are countless ways to do so. One powerful and meaningful approach is through acts of kindness. By extending love, compassion, and support to others, we can truly embody the essence of God’s love and make a positive impact on those around us.

1. Showing empathy:

One way to express God’s love is by showing empathy towards others. This involves putting ourselves in their shoes, understanding their struggles and challenges, and offering a listening ear or a helping hand. By showing genuine care and concern, we can offer comfort and support to those in need.

2. Practicing forgiveness:

Forgiveness is a powerful act of kindness that reflects God’s love. By letting go of grudges and choosing to forgive those who have wronged us, we demonstrate a compassionate and merciful heart. Through forgiveness, we can heal broken relationships and offer others a chance for redemption.

3. Volunteering and serving:

Engaging in acts of service and volunteering is another way to express God’s love. By dedicating our time and skills to help those in need, we can make a tangible difference in their lives. Whether it’s serving at a local shelter, participating in community projects, or assisting the elderly, our actions can bring joy and hope to others.

4. Extending kindness to strangers:

God’s love knows no boundaries, and neither should ours. Expressing God’s love through acts of kindness means reaching out to strangers and showing them compassion and care. Whether it’s a simple act of holding the door open, offering a smile, or lending a helping hand, these small gestures can have a profound impact on someone’s day and remind them of God’s love.

Spreading Love through Small Gestures and Random Acts of Kindness

In this section, I will share some meaningful ways in which we can express love to others through simple gestures and random acts of kindness. These actions, although seemingly small, have the power to make a significant impact on someone’s life and bring joy and happiness to those around us.

1. Smile and Greet

A warm smile and a friendly greeting can go a long way in brightening someone’s day. By acknowledging others with kindness and respect, we create a positive atmosphere and show that we care about their presence. Small acts like holding the door open for someone, saying “thank you” or “please,” and offering a genuine compliment can make a person feel valued and loved.

See also  How deep can you go before water pressure kills you

2. Acts of Service

Engaging in acts of service is a wonderful way to demonstrate love and compassion towards others. Whether it is helping an elderly neighbor with their groceries, volunteering at a local charity, or offering a listening ear to someone in need, these gestures show that we are willing to go out of our way to make a difference in someone’s life. Acts of service not only benefit the recipient but also fill our hearts with a sense of purpose and fulfillment.

3. Random Acts of Kindness

Random acts of kindness are spontaneous acts that bring joy and love to others without any specific reason. They can include leaving a kind note for a coworker, paying for a stranger’s coffee, or surprising a friend with a small gift. These acts have the power to uplift someone’s spirit and remind them that there is kindness and goodness in the world. By spreading love through these random acts, we inspire others to do the same and create a ripple effect of positivity and compassion.

Demonstrating God’s Love Through Forgiveness and Understanding

One powerful way to show God’s love to others is through the acts of forgiveness and understanding. By extending forgiveness and seeking to understand others, we can reflect God’s love and grace in our relationships and interactions.

Forgiveness is a profound act of love that allows us to release the burdens of resentment, anger, and hurt. It involves letting go of the desire for revenge and choosing to respond with compassion and empathy instead. When we forgive others, we demonstrate God’s love by imitating His willingness to forgive and reconcile with us. Through forgiveness, we create an atmosphere of healing and restoration, nurturing genuine connections with others.

Understanding is another vital aspect of demonstrating God’s love. It requires putting ourselves in the shoes of others, seeking to comprehend their perspectives, experiences, and emotions. When we strive to understand others, we acknowledge their inherent worth and value, just as God sees and understands us. This empathy and compassion enable us to respond with kindness, patience, and acceptance, fostering a sense of belonging and unity.

Forgiveness and understanding go hand in hand in demonstrating God’s love. By forgiving others, we show that we are willing to let go of past wrongs and extend grace. Through understanding, we create space for empathy, promoting genuine connection and healing. Together, these acts reflect God’s unconditional love and demonstrate our commitment to living out His teachings.
